Kazakhstan is making a significant move in the crypto world by allocating $350 million from its gold and foreign currency reserves for investments. This decision seeks to elevate the nation as a prominent crypto hub, yet it has garnered varied feedback from the community.

Investment Overview

This initiative, managed by the National Investment Corporation, aims to channel funds primarily through hedge funds and venture capital. The timing aligns with Kazakhstan's plan to regulate and liberalize its crypto market, enhancing its attractiveness for both enthusiasts and investors.
